The children’s sailing and boating courses are intended for 7–13-year-olds who are interested in sailing and boating. Participants must be able to swim, because it is not unheard for dinghy sailors to fall into the sea. Being able to swim 25 metres in a swimming pool is the minimum requirement.

What you will learn?

Children learn the basics of sailing while having fun on the water through games and playful exercises. We have exercises on the shore, in the classroom and obviously on the water. Weather permitting, we also enjoy capsizing the dinghy and climbing back aboard.

In the boating section of the course, participants learn the basics of navigation and safe boating — such as recognizing nautical signs, steering according to them, and essential boating skills (like the most important knots).

Beginners’ course

During the beginner’s course, you will learn the basics, such as getting your boat ready for sailing, starting off from the shore, the basics skills of sailing, and returning to shore. You will learn to use the rudder to steer and the sheet to adjust the sail, to tack (turn a boat’s head into and through the wind) and gybe (swing the sail across a following wind).

Participants in the beginner course don’t need any previous sailing or boating experience. All the necessary skills are practiced together during the course week. If you already have some experience on the water, take a look at our advanced course options.

Advanced course

The advanced sailing and boating course is ideal for young sailors who have already completed a beginners’ course, taken part in a sailing group, or who already have similar sailing experience.

In the advanced course you will learn more advanced sailing skills such as sailing into the wind (tacking) and into the tailwind, sailing different types of courses, cruising and much more!
